溫馨提示×

c#與vb.net 應用范圍啥

c#
小樊
81
2024-10-18 13:55:26
欄目: 編程語言

C#和VB.NET都是微軟推出的編程語言,它們各自具有獨特的應用范圍和特點。以下是它們的主要應用范圍:

  1. C#的應用范圍
  • Windows應用程序開發(fā):C#最初是為Windows平臺開發(fā)的,因此它在Windows應用程序開發(fā)中具有廣泛的應用。通過使用C#,開發(fā)者可以創(chuàng)建各種Windows應用程序,如桌面應用程序、Windows服務、Windows窗體應用程序等。
  • Web應用程序開發(fā):隨著ASP.NET的推出,C#也逐漸用于Web應用程序的開發(fā)。通過ASP.NET,開發(fā)者可以使用C#來創(chuàng)建動態(tài)的、交互式的Web應用程序。
  • 游戲開發(fā):C#也常用于游戲開發(fā),尤其是在Unity游戲引擎中。Unity引擎支持使用C#作為編程語言,這使得開發(fā)者可以使用C#來創(chuàng)建各種類型的游戲,包括2D游戲、3D游戲等。
  • 移動應用開發(fā):通過Xamarin框架,C#也可以用于移動應用的開發(fā)。這使得開發(fā)者可以使用同一套代碼庫來創(chuàng)建跨平臺的移動應用程序,如Android應用程序和iOS應用程序。
  1. VB.NET的應用范圍
  • Windows應用程序開發(fā):與C#類似,VB.NET也常用于Windows應用程序的開發(fā)。通過使用VB.NET,開發(fā)者可以創(chuàng)建各種Windows應用程序,如桌面應用程序、Windows服務等。
  • Web應用程序開發(fā):VB.NET也可以用于Web應用程序的開發(fā)。通過ASP.NET,開發(fā)者可以使用VB.NET來創(chuàng)建動態(tài)的、交互式的Web應用程序。
  • 企業(yè)級應用開發(fā):VB.NET在企業(yè)級應用開發(fā)中也有一定的應用。由于其易于學習和使用的特點,VB.NET常用于構建各種企業(yè)級應用程序,如CRM系統(tǒng)、ERP系統(tǒng)等。
  • 自動化和腳本編寫:VB.NET還可以用于編寫自動化腳本和程序。通過使用VB.NET,開發(fā)者可以編寫腳本來自動執(zhí)行一些任務,如文件處理、數(shù)據(jù)庫操作等。

總的來說,C#和VB.NET都是功能強大的編程語言,它們各自具有獨特的應用范圍和特點。在選擇使用哪種語言時,開發(fā)者需要根據(jù)項目的具體需求、團隊的技術棧和個人偏好等因素進行綜合考慮。

0